CNC vertical turning lathes (VTLs) and CNC vertical lathe machines are important instruments in precision machining, recognized for their ability to handle large, heavy, and sophisticated workpieces with significant accuracy. They differ from typical horizontal lathes by orienting the workpiece vertically, which presents one of a kind positive aspects, especially for larger sized and heavier sections.

1. CNC Vertical Turning Lathe (VTL):
Purpose: A CNC vertical turning lathe is meant to maintain the workpiece vertically even though the reducing Device moves horizontally across the aspect. This setup is ideal for turning big and hefty factors, as gravity really helps to stabilize the workpiece.
Positive aspects:
Managing Major Workpieces: The vertical orientation is superb for giant, bulky sections like automotive wheels, gear blanks, and weighty flanges.
Stability and Precision: The workpiece's fat is dispersed evenly, improving steadiness and strengthening machining precision.
Substantial Production Efficiency: Automatic Device variations, multi-axis Handle, and higher-pace spindles allow for for productive and specific machining of enormous factors.
Applications: Employed thoroughly in industries for example aerospace, automotive, and hefty products production, for factors like turbine housings, brake discs, and flywheels.
two. CNC Vertical Lathe Device:
Function: Comparable to the VTL, a CNC vertical lathe machine focuses on turning operations in which the workpiece is mounted vertically. It is flexible, giving superior precision in the two tough and high-quality turning operations.
Positive aspects:
Successful Material Removing: The vertical set up permits helpful chip removing, as gravity pulls chips clear of the workpiece, reducing the risk of re-cutting and Software wear.
Adaptability: Ideal for different turning duties, from hefty-duty Cnc Vertical Turning Lathe roughing to higher-precision finishing.
Reduced Ground House: Vertical lathes normally Have got a scaled-down footprint in comparison to big horizontal lathes, producing them ideal for workshops where Place is often a constraint.
Apps: Ideal for machining cylindrical parts such as valve bodies, bearing housings, and other spherical or cylindrical parts in industries like automotive, electrical power generation, and construction equipment.
